Common Tangia Issues and How to Solve Them

Last updated November 15, 2023

Introduction

While Tangia is designed to be user-friendly and efficient, like any technology, users may occasionally encounter issues. This guide aims to address some of the most common problems users face with Tangia and provide clear, step-by-step solutions to resolve them quickly and effectively.

Step-by-Step Guide

Issue 1: Difficulty Connecting Tangia to Streaming Software

  • Check Software Compatibility: Ensure that your streaming software is compatible with Tangia.
  • Update Both Applications: Make sure both your streaming software and Tangia are updated to the latest versions.
  • Follow Official Integration Guides: Revisit Tangia’s official guides or tutorials for integrating with your specific streaming software.

Issue 2: Delayed or Non-Functioning Alerts

  • Check Internet Connection: A stable internet connection is crucial. Verify your connection speed and stability.
  • Review Alert Settings: Double-check your alert settings in Tangia to ensure they are configured correctly.
  • Test Alerts: Use the test feature in Tangia to send a test alert and confirm if it’s working as intended.

Issue 3: Overlay Issues During Streaming

  • Inspect Overlay Settings: Ensure that the overlay settings in Tangia match the requirements of your streaming software.
  • Reposition Overlays: Adjust the position and size of the overlays to ensure they are not being blocked or overlapped by other elements.
  • Restart Streaming Software: Sometimes, simply restarting your streaming software can resolve overlay issues.

Issue 4: Audio Issues with TTS (Text-to-Speech)

  • Check Audio Input and Output Settings: Ensure that your audio settings in Tangia and your streaming software are correctly configured.
  • Update TTS Settings: If using custom TTS settings, review and adjust them for clarity and volume.
  • Test TTS Feature: Conduct a TTS test within Tangia to verify if the issue is within the application or the streaming setup.

Issue 5: Account Synchronization Problems

  • Re-Login to Your Account: Log out of your Tangia account and then log back in to refresh the account synchronization.
  • Clear Browser Cache: If using a web-based version of Tangia, clear your browser cache and cookies.
  • Contact Support: If issues persist, contact Tangia’s support team for assistance with account-related problems.

Issue 6: Customization Features Not Working Properly

  • Review Customization Options: Recheck the customization settings you have applied to ensure they are saved and applied correctly.
  • Limit Resource-Intensive Features: If your stream is lagging, reduce the use of resource-intensive features or graphics.
  • Seek Community Advice: Sometimes, other users might have encountered similar issues and can offer solutions in community forums or help sections.
